Jugglers in Sodus tomorrow

You may have seen juggling, but you haven't truly experienced it until you've seen the explosive, inventive juggling of brothers Matthew and Jason Tardy in their show, TWO: HIGH ENERGY JUGGLING!

The Sodus Central School District brings the dynamic duo to the Sodus High Auditorium on Wednesday, September 27, for its fourth annual Character Education Kick-Off.

Jason and Matthew Tardy, known as TWO, have amazed audiences at events across the country and abroad. They have appeared on local and national television shows such. as WGME's Daybreak, PBS's True North, and CBS Sunday Morning. The brothers' performing career started as teenagers in Maine when they presented some sketch comedy at a local community talent show. Michael Miclon, The Stand-Up Juggler, noticed their natural rapport with the audience and encouraged them to develop their talent. Not long after this, Jason and Matthew accepted an invitation to apprentice and tour with Miclon.

Matthew and Jason have created a show that features everything from high tech juggling and fire eating to physical comedy and full body contortion. They juggle various 'props of doom,' perform mind-bending choreography, and in complete darkness, create streaks of color changing light that glide through the air. Through the use of their spectacular stunts, TWO will deliver a message that focuses on the importance of setting goals, making positive choices, and how to reach for the stars.

There will be two morning performances during the school day for Sodus students. Community and family members are invited to join the fun during a 7 p.m. evening performance in the Sodus High Auditorium. This show is free to the public and promises to be an evening of entertainment you won't want to miss!
